当前位置:首页 > 行业动态 > 正文

php如何调用sql数据

在PHP中,可以使用PDO或mysqli扩展来调用SQL数据。首先建立数据库连接,然后编写SQL查询语句,最后执行查询并处理结果。

PHP如何调用SQL数据

单元1:建立数据库连接

使用mysqli或PDO扩展来建立与数据库的连接。

需要提供数据库主机名、用户名、密码和数据库名称等信息。

单元2:编写SQL查询语句

根据需求编写相应的SQL查询语句,可以使用SELECT语句来获取数据。

可以添加WHERE子句来过滤数据,使用JOIN子句来关联多个表等。

单元3:执行SQL查询

使用mysqli或PDO对象的query方法执行SQL查询语句。

将查询结果保存在变量中,以便后续处理。

单元4:处理查询结果

使用fetch_assoc、fetch_array或fetch_object等方法获取查询结果的每一行数据。

可以通过列名或索引来访问具体的字段值。

单元5:关闭数据库连接

在完成数据处理后,使用mysqli或PDO对象的close方法关闭数据库连接。

释放资源并确保数据的完整性。

相关问题与解答:

问题1:如何在PHP中使用预处理语句防止SQL注入攻击?

解答:可以使用预处理语句(Prepared Statement)来防止SQL注入攻击,预处理语句可以将参数与SQL语句分开,通过占位符的方式传递参数,从而避免了直接拼接字符串可能导致的安全破绽。

问题2:如何处理查询结果中的错误或异常情况?

解答:在执行查询时,可能会出现错误或异常情况,例如连接失败、查询语法错误等,可以使用trycatch语句来捕获异常,并进行相应的处理,例如输出错误信息或回滚事务等,还可以使用mysqli或PDO对象的方法来获取错误信息,以便进行调试和修复。

0